Hi Annie, yes, they should be clipped up to the BC. The ocotpus in the one shot is hanging down, if I were out of air and needed to get at my buddy's spare, and it was dangling, it would not be easy to grab...they sell an "octopus clip/holder" that costs about a buck...and the computers can be hooked up to a clip that has a cord so you can pull it and check the gauges and then it retracts...I certainly don't mean to pick on these divers, but it needs to be pointed out, as some don't realize the hazards:-(

Great bunch of West Canadian Divers.... I do hope they read the thread and remember the advice not to dangle...

One thought in their support, though is that quite often visitors to any of the islands rent gear locally.... and where they may have their own gear set up properly, many times rental gear is not equipped to allow securing the dangly bits.
Quite often because the clips, snaps and catches tend to disappear, and while the cost of 1 or 2 clips is very reasonable, imagine having a rack of dive gear where clips must be replaced at least monthly.
